Strictly Come Dancing stars Ellie Leach and Bobby Brazier are reportedly on 'good terms' after their rumoured romance ended.

Former Coronation Street star Ellie, who won the 2024 contest alongside professional dancer Vito Coppola, is said to have been in a relationship with EastEnders actor Bobby earlier this year. But the romance apparently fizzled out six weeks after the Strictly Live! Tour ended, with the pair remaining close pals.

The stars are said to have grown close during the tour, which took them across the UK from January until the middle of February. However, just one month later, it was claimed that Ellie and Bobby had gone their separate ways, and in an interview this weekend, the 23-year-old said they are 'great friends'.

A source told The Sun in March: "Love blossomed between them when they were in close quarters on the tour, but once that ended they both spent much less time together. That gave them space to think about the future, which is likely to take them in very different directions over the coming year or two. So they decided the best thing to do was quit while they were ahead and while they were still pals, because they both really cherish the friendship they have."

Over the weekend, it was reported that Ellie was 'upset' over claims her reported relationship with the son of late Big Brother star, Jade Goody, was not the 'real deal'. A source told New magazine: "Ellie is really hurt that people are saying her relationship is fake - it's definitely not. They're trying to keep things under wraps, get to know each under and just have fun.

"But these comments, including that it could be a showmance like with Vito, or that it's fake, are causing pain." They continued: "It's still early days for them, but their relationship is genuine. It's upsetting to hear things like: 'It's a set up', but their friends and family are telling them to rise above it and not to listen to them."

In an interview with The Sun on Saturday, Ellie, 23, refused to comment on any romance but did say that she and Bobby, 20, are 'great friends'. She said: "We'd obviously built an amazing friendship during the show, but it was really nice to be able to spend time with each other – and with everyone – on the tour."

The former Corrie star said that "time constraints" on Friday and Saturday during filming meant they didn't "really get to spend time with each other" but once they were on tour they "were able to be together and learn about each other."

Ellie explained the reason why they found each other in the show. She said: "I think doing that at the same time as someone else gives you something to relate to and to bond over. We're great friends. We got along really well, and we still do." The outlet added that Ellie "wouldn't confirm or deny that she and Bobby were together".
